Many people are misunderstanding. Hotel Ghasr and Hotel Amir Kabir are different. The front side is Hotel Amir Kabir that is a hostel. The back side is Hotel Ghasr. The hostel is luxurious at reception, but the room is cheep. There are only two beds in the room, the toilet and the shower are shared. There is no towel. But Hotel Ghasr is a 3 star hotel. very clean. Hotel Amir Kabir is IRR 600,000 (USD 15), Hotel Ghasr is IRR 1,000,000 (USD 25). Hotel Amir Kabir and Hotel Ghasr are same company.
